Pallada finished the memorial regatta
On February 20, at 00.00, the 200-mile regatta dedicated to the 200th anniversary of the discovery of Antarctica and the 75th anniversary of the Victory in the Great Patriotic War was started.
The participants had arrived to the starting line in advance and stopped the main engines. So, the ships appeared to be at the mercy of the waves and wind. Soon the regatta began. The regatta start was preceded by joint maneuvers held a day before. The maneuvers helped the ships to coordinate the details and to keep safe distance while sailing. Pallada's crew bravely bore all the misfortunes during the regatta. Firstly she got into gale force 7 area, then blasts of wind tore her five sails to pieces, so the Pallada finished up in third place. However, there are no winners or losers in this regatta. The very idea of the event is rather symbolic. It underlines that every participant of the regatta belongs in the history of Maritime Russia and shares the traditions of Russian sailing fleet. The key task of the expedition is to remind the whole world about the Russian seafarers who made the great geographical discovery of Antarctica 200 years ago.
Mst Nikolay Zorchenko thanked the crew, cadets and ship boys for their dedication and hard work with the sails.
